Why hydration quietly shapes digestion, urinary health, and long-term resilience
Hydration is often treated as a background detail of feeding—something we assume a water bowl alone will handle. In reality, hydration is structural. It influences how food behaves once eaten, how nutrients are absorbed, how waste is processed, and how much physiological strain the body carries day to day.
For dogs and cats alike, water is not simply something added after a meal. It is meant to be part of the meal itself. When moisture is consistently missing—or when food resists rehydration during digestion—the body adapts. Over time, those adaptations can quietly shape digestion, stool quality, urinary concentration, and long-term resilience.
The issue isn’t dryness alone—it’s whether food can take water back in once it’s eaten.
When hydration quietly works against the body
Hydration-related strain rarely appears as a single, dramatic symptom. More often, it shows up as subtle patterns that are easy to dismiss or misattribute:
- Vomiting or regurgitation shortly after meals
- Large, dense stools or inconsistent stool quality
- Fast eating followed by digestive upset
- Strong-smelling or highly concentrated urine
- Cats that drink very little water despite constant access
These signs are not diagnoses. They are signals—often shaped by how food and water interact during digestion rather than by a single ingredient or feeding choice.
Understanding hydration means looking beyond the bowl and into the meal itself.
Hydration as a biological system, not a preference
Water supports nearly every physiological process: enzyme activation, nutrient transport, circulation, temperature regulation, waste removal, and tissue repair. During digestion specifically, hydration determines how efficiently food can be processed.
When a meal enters the stomach, moisture affects:
- How quickly food softens and breaks apart
- How evenly enzymes can access nutrients
- How smoothly food moves through the digestive tract
If food arrives already hydrated—or can easily rehydrate—the digestive system works with it. If food is dense, dry, or slow to absorb moisture, digestion requires more internal resources, including body water. Over time, this can increase digestive effort and physiological load.
Why food structure matters as much as moisture
Discussions about hydration often focus on moisture percentage alone. But moisture content does not tell the full story. Food structure—how a food is physically changed during processing—plays a major role in how that food behaves once eaten.
Different preservation methods create very different outcomes:
- Air-dried and dehydrated foods lose water through heat and time. As moisture is removed, muscle fibers contract and collapse, creating a dense, compact food that may resist rehydration.
- Freeze-dried foods remove water through sublimation. This process preserves much of the original cellular structure, leaving the food porous and more receptive to moisture.
Both formats are low in moisture. The difference lies in how easily water can re-enter the food during digestion. Foods that resist rehydration rely more heavily on stomach acid and body water to break down, particularly when eaten quickly or in large pieces.
This distinction becomes especially important for animals prone to fast eating, sensitive digestion, or limited thirst drive.
Why hydration plays a different role for dogs and cats
Dogs and cats do not share the same hydration biology.
Dogs generally have a stronger thirst drive and are more likely to compensate for dry meals by drinking water. While hydration still matters deeply for digestive comfort and stool quality, many dogs are better equipped to adjust.
Cats, by contrast, evolved as desert-adapted hunters. Their natural diet provided moisture through prey, not through drinking. As a result, many cats instinctively consume very little water unless moisture is present in their food.
When meals are consistently low in moisture, some cats may be more vulnerable to:
- Chronically concentrated urine
- Increased urinary tract irritation
- Hydration-related stress compounding other factors
This does not imply a single “correct” way to feed. It highlights that moisture compatibility tends to matter more for cats over long periods of time.
Hydration, urine concentration, and long-term comfort
One of hydration’s most important roles is waste removal. When hydration is adequate, urine is more dilute and flows more freely. When hydration is limited, urine becomes more concentrated.
Concentrated urine does not automatically lead to problems. However, over time—and especially when combined with stress—concentration can increase irritation within the urinary tract.
Supporting hydration through feeding is one way to reduce unnecessary strain and support urinary comfort proactively rather than reactively.
Modern feeding and unintended hydration gaps
Many modern feeding formats prioritize convenience, shelf stability, and caloric density. While these qualities can be useful, they also mean that moisture—once naturally present in food—must now be considered intentionally.
Dense foods fed quickly, dry meals without moisture support, and large portions of slow-rehydrating foods can all increase digestive effort. These effects are often subtle at first and easy to overlook.

Supporting hydration gently through feeding
- Notice how quickly food softens when exposed to moisture
- Encourage slower eating when meals are dry or dense
- Incorporate moisture-rich foods where appropriate
- Observe stool quality, urine output, and digestion over time
Small, consistent adjustments often make the greatest difference.
Frequently asked questions
Is a water bowl enough?
For some animals, yes. For others—especially cats—hydration through food plays a significant role.
Does low moisture always mean digestive risk?
Not necessarily. How easily a food rehydrates often matters more than moisture percentage alone.
Can hydration influence urinary comfort?
Hydration affects urine concentration, which can play a role in long-term urinary health.
